The trial involving hush money connected to former President Trump is in its seventh day of testimony on Friday.
A forensic analyst from the Manhattan DA’s office is anticipated to take the stand again. Doug Daus spent part of Thursday explaining to jurors how he examined the phones of ex-fixer Michael Cohen.
More witnesses are scheduled to testify later today.
